What Are Smart Meters?

Smart meters are modern electric meters that use advanced metering technology to record electricity usage in real time. Unlike traditional meters that rely on manual meter reading, smart meters provide usage information digitally and transmit it wirelessly to the utility company. This eliminates the need for a meter reader to visit your property and ensures more accurate billing.

How Smart Meters Work

Smart meters work through a combination of advanced metering infrastructure and wireless communication. These devices collect electricity usage data in 15-minute intervals and send it to the utility company via low-power radio frequency signals. The collected meter data is then used to monitor energy consumption and improve the reliability of the electric grid.

Accessing and Using Smart Meter Data

The ability to access detailed usage data is one of the standout features of smart meters. Electricity customers can log into their utility company’s online portals or apps to view real-time data on their energy consumption. This makes it easier to track usage, identify trends, and optimize energy use.

How to Access Smart Meter Data

Utility companies provide secure platforms where customers can view their electricity usage in kilowatt-hours. Many also offer energy management apps for cell phones, enabling access to usage data on the go.

Interpreting Usage Information for Energy Management

Smart meter data provides insights into your electricity consumption patterns, helping you identify energy-intensive appliances and practices. For example, analyzing time-of-use trends might reveal opportunities to run appliances during lower electricity rate periods.

Safety and Security of Smart Meters

As with any advanced technology, safety and security are essential considerations for smart meters. These devices are designed to meet stringent safety standards and protect customer data through robust encryption protocols.

Addressing Health Concerns

Smart meters use low-power radio frequency transmissions, similar to those emitted by cell phones and microwaves. The FCC regulates these emissions, ensuring they fall well within safe exposure limits.

Data Security and Privacy

Utility companies employ advanced security measures to protect your usage information. Encryption and authentication protocols safeguard the data transmitted by smart meters, ensuring privacy and preventing unauthorized access.

Opt-Out Options and Alternatives

Texas electricity customers can choose to opt out of smart meter programs. However, this may result in additional charges or reduced access to the benefits of advanced metering infrastructure.

Alternatives to Smart Meters

If you prefer not to install a smart meter, consider standalone energy trackers or apps. While these options don’t offer the same integration with the electric utility, they provide basic insights into energy usage.
